Social Media Tools Quizlet

Quizlet has become a powerful platform for both students and educators to create, share, and engage with learning content. Through its interactive tools, users can design custom study sets and quizzes to enhance their educational experience. This makes Quizlet a unique combination of educational utility and social interaction, offering a space for collaboration and shared learning resources.

Key Features of Quizlet:

  • Custom study sets: Users can create personalized flashcards for various subjects.
  • Collaborative learning: Students and teachers can share sets, improving access to diverse materials.
  • Study modes: Quizlet provides several interactive modes, including “Learn,” “Match,” and “Write,” to make studying more engaging.

Benefits of Using Quizlet in Social Media Context:

  1. Facilitates peer-to-peer learning and sharing of study materials across platforms.
  2. Encourages participation in group study activities, making learning more social.
  3. Enables the creation of public study sets, fostering collaboration between users worldwide.

Quizlet bridges the gap between traditional learning and modern social media engagement, turning studying into a community-driven activity.

Quizlet Study Set Types:

Study Set Type Description
Flashcards Simple, digital flashcards for memorization and review.
Test A simulated test environment with various question types.
Match A timed game where users match terms and definitions.
